This exhibition showcases a recently acquired series of nine photographs by Tuan Andrew Nguyen (b. 1976 in Saigon, Vietnam) titled From Saigon to Saigon. The photographs document the handwritten correspondence from a young Vietnamese rapper based in Ho Chi Minh City to an African American rapper, who adopted the stage moniker 'Saigon' after reading Wallace Terry’s Bloods: An Oral History of the Vietnam War, detailing the discriminatory experiences African Americans endured during the American-Vietnam War. The photographs illuminate the interaction of history, politics, and popular culture in the rapidly shifting landscape of contemporary Vietnamese society.
Transcription of Letters From Saigon to Saigon. This transcription preserves the spelling, grammar, crossed-out words, and highlights of the original text. All formatting in the digital transcription reflects the nature of the handwritten letter.

Page 1
Day 29-03 2008
Hey man Saigon I’m Wowy was born and growup at the country have a name like u. Your name and you talent maked me write this letter. I’m a Rapper in VN. a Different between you and me is a factor and is all what I’m talking about in this letter (Sorry! Say how are you to another guy not my homies is hard that’s not my style)
You r black ..... and .... I’m yellow. you living at a hiphop country. I’m living at a country have 50% population never know what’s a fucking HipHop.
I’m to Follow u by all new on my collection in website (I don’t know websites is wrong 100% or right 100%?), and I know when you live in the jail you saw that name on your newspaper and use. What u know about that?? U like it? Or u have some think about that and use that name?
I’m very very wanna know; because I’m a Saigon
Page 2
Today u r famous Rapper; I’m not! in VN no one like real rap music. if rap music talk about love like pop music everybody like it (Rapper like shit) some singer wanna Famous? Ok! buy some music buy some “Fan”. I don’t care about that! I’m still rap because I like it; What’s I think I talk about that; What I saw I sing about that. I have another Friend is a foreigner and he said “If you live in another country like new york you can be famous; rich” Too funny!? That question make me think “is that right??” and that is my question I wanna ask u “is that right??” my music and your music; I know have a distance. but if u be me; a son of Saigon country think about that!
Make money and be famous by rap music? Or listen rap music; and wanna make a song; money and famous is a award of rap music? You r famous, Rich! (I don’t Know?) But when I watch your video clip I think you have both. A question make me very wonder. “Rap music is your tool to make money or Rap music is your style? Interest?
Page 3
I have a idea shine in my mind “What about Saigon visit Saigon?” I wanna see that! I can see Saigon have a map of Saigon. Saigon go to Hood of Saigon; Saigon sing at Saigon. (I can see at my mind “A black People) I can see fancy by my imagination “ A black People wear a mit. mit. I’m sure 100% everybody in the street will be look at you. not by your fame. By your crazy” (you can’t wear new era when you drive motobike to get some fresh air. and you can’t wear your ring and bling when you go to the street (?) find some chick. Do You Know Why? “Vietnamese Law” you know what I mean man. It’s very close image of a black people have show at Saigon. Trust me no one sing follow you or do some thing like Put your hand up. they just “look” and “listen”. May be they will be think “you’r bad singer”. HaHa you know why. That’s very simple. They don’t Know What are you talking about. But. If your you are dancer, dance for a sing pop-singer in my country
Page 4
and you have good dance. Everybody will be look at you because you have a black skin You are famous some where. I don’t know. But in Viet MNam you just a people. You how know what I mean. I’m not apartheid or ironical about your skin color. I’m chink (I hate KKK). I just wanna talk to you “VietNam music or Saigon music is a scope everybody call that’s root and have ferment (I hope someday you come to VN and visit Saigon).
I don’t know anything else to talk to you; and I don’t know how to write a letter letter clearly espeacially like a famous person like you so I just want to tell you like this yesterday some mother Fucker polices come to my house and thy stole 2 buld electriaties.
I just write some bullshit words to make it full the letter So end of here get more and more money I wish you like this When you visit VN buy for me hoodie.
Dear Saigon.
[signed “HWOWYH”]
